Indian skipper Rohit Sharma, Virat Kohli alongside several other Indian cricketers celebrated Ganesh Chaturthi on September 19 (Tuesday).

Indian skipper Rohit Sharma and former captain Virat Kohli celebrated Ganesh Chaturthi as the duo brought Ganpatti Bappa home on Tuesday. At present, both Kohli and Rohit are having some free time before he joins the Indian squad for the third ODI clash against Australia. Under the leadership of Rohit, the Men in Blue completed a dominating performance in the Asia Cup as they defeated Sri Lanka in the final match of the competition. India rested regular captain Rohit Sharma, Hardik Pandya, Virat Kohli and Kuldeep Yadav for the first two games, with K L Rahul named as the captain. Ravindra Jadeja was named as the vice-captain for the first two games, while Shreyas Iyer has also been ruled fit for the series. India have a strong pace attack for the Australia series comprising Asia Cup final hero Mohammed Siraj, Jasprit Bumrah, Mohammed Shami, Shardul Thakur and Prasidh Krishna.

“Rohit and Virat have been around forever. Hardik – we want to manage the workload. Kuldeep’s an amazing player. At some stage, more than physical, guys needs a mental break. From the third game, everyone’s available to play. It also gives opportunity to the guys sitting on the bench. Also Asia Cup gave them a lot of game time,” said chief selector Ajit Agarkar after the selection committee meeting.

KL Rahul to lead India in first Two ODIs

Squad for the 1st two ODIs: KL Rahul (C & WK), Ravindra Jadeja (Vice-captain), Ruturaj Gaikwad, Shubman Gill, Shreyas Iyer, Suryakumar Yadav, Tilak Varma, Ishan Kishan (wicketkeeper), Shardul Thakur, Washington Sundar, R Ashwin, Jasprit Bumrah, Mohd. Shami, Mohd. Siraj, Prasidh Krishna

Squad for the 3rd & final ODI: Rohit Sharma (C), Hardik Pandya, (Vice-captain), Shubman Gill, Virat Kohli, Shreyas Iyer, Suryakumar Yadav, KL Rahul (wicketkeeper), Ishan Kishan (wicketkeeper), Ravindra Jadeja, Shardul Thakur, Axar Patel*, Washington Sundar, Kuldeep Yadav, R Ashwin, Jasprit Bumrah, Mohd. Shami, Mohd. Siraj
